Biography

A commanding duo that evokes the intensity of Ian Curtis and Grace Jones, among others, Light Asylum is the project of vocalist Shannon Funchess and multi-instrumentalist Bruno Coviello. Funchess developed her powerful contralto over the years by singing in the choir of a Southern Baptist church as a child, and adding Odetta, Nina Simone, Alison Moyet, the Cocteau Twins, and Bauhaus to her list of influences as a teen. Funchess moved from Mississippi to Europe and then to Washington state, where she performed in underground rock bands along with like-minded groups such as 7 Year Bitch before moving to New York in 2001. There, she became an in-demand vocalist for TV on the Radio, Telepathe, and !!!, of which she became a touring member; she also played with the electroclash outfits Durty Nanas and tha Pumpsta & Derriere. Meanwhile, Coviello grew up in New Jersey and developed an early fascination for house music that he fed by sneaking to New York to see Danny Tenaglia. He also performed as one-man synth pop band the Dreamies before meeting Funchess while both of them were in bands touring with the rap act Bunny Rabbit; after bonding over their shared love for Clan of Xymox, they began writing and recording together. In 2010, Light Asylum self-released their debut EP, In Tension, which featured the single "Dark Allies"; in May 2012, the group's self-titled debut album followed on Mexican Summer.
